SENNEBOGEN 825 M Demolition – Series E
Year 2025 · 379 h · Demolition machine
Demolition machine built in 2025 with 379 operating hours. Hydraulic
package with Tool Control and dedicated enable valves for shear and
hydraulic hammer, plus multitool preparation for quick couplers. The cab
elevates hydraulically to 2.8 m and tilts 30°, with armoured glazing and
FOPS level 2 roof guard.
TECHNICAL DATA
Drive .......... Cummins B6.7, 129 kW (175 hp), Stage V with DPF
Equipment ...... K12 ULM special kinematics: 6.8 m compact boom,
5.0 m special grab stick for quick couplers
Hydraulics ..... ULM hydraulics with Tool Control, enable valves for
shear and hammer, drain line to stick end
Undercarriage .. Mobile MP26, 4-point outriggers PAH4, all-wheel drive
with 2-speed powershift
Ballasting ..... additional 1.1 t ballast in counterweight
Tyres .......... Solid rubber 10.00-20
Cab ............ MAXCAB, elevating to 2.8 m, tilting 30°, armoured
glazing, FOPS level 2 roof guard
Serial no. ..... 825.0.4377
Further equipment includes multitool preparation, piston rod guard on
the ULM cylinder, air filter enclosure, lift cylinder pressure display
in SENCON with audible warning, automatic central lubrication,
Hydro-Clean filtration, camera system and emergency control.

Whenever possible, make it a priority to visit the seller and inspect the vehicle in person. If feasible, arrange for a third-party pre-purchase inspection of the vehicle. This can uncover potential issues that might not be visible in photos or mentioned in the advert.
Ensure you sign a detailed sale agreement to protect your rights and confirm the terms of the transaction.
Proceed with payment only after signing the sale agreement. A small down payment to reserve the vehicle is common but should be done cautiously.
Confirm the seller's authenticity by gathering detailed information and checking reviews or ratings from previous buyers. Look for dealer icons on Truck1 to identify verified sellers and ensure a safer purchasing experience.
Compare the prices of similar vehicles using the Comparison tool to identify any unusual offers. Be wary of prices that deviate significantly from the market norm, as they may indicate potential issues or fraud.
Ask the seller for details about the vehicle’s history and usage conditions. A genuine seller will be transparent and willing to share this information, helping you assess if the vehicle meets your needs.
Arrange to see and test the vehicle, looking for signs of wear or damage. Consider a pre-purchase inspection by a professional mechanic to uncover any hidden issues and ensure the vehicle's safety and reliability.
Before any transaction, ensure a detailed sale agreement is in place outlining all terms and conditions. Use secure payment methods and verify transaction details to protect against fraud.
